The Building Materials Flame Tester is a specialized laboratory instrument designed to assess the flammability and ignition resistance of various construction materials, including insulation, wall panels, plastic sheets, and floor coverings. It simulates real-life fire exposure conditions to evaluate how materials react to direct flame, measuring critical parameters such as flame spread rate, ignition time, and heat release. Built to comply with international testing standards such as ASTM, ISO, and BIS, this tester is essential for quality control, safety certification, and regulatory compliance in the construction and manufacturing sectors. With features like adjustable flame intensity, precision temperature monitoring, and a transparent observation chamber, it offers reliable and accurate testing for engineers, manufacturers, and research labs committed to enhancing fire safety in buildings.
The Building Materials Flame Tester is an essential instrument for evaluating the fire resistance and combustion behavior of construction materials under controlled conditions. It plays a critical role in ensuring that materials used in buildings—such as plastic panels, foam insulation, wood composites, textile-based wall coverings, and ceiling materials—meet fire safety standards before being approved for public or residential use. This tester simulates direct flame exposure and allows precise measurement of flame propagation, ignition time, after-flame time, and self-extinguishing behavior.
Equipped with a robust burner system, adjustable flame height, and integrated digital temperature control, the flame tester provides high accuracy and repeatability for laboratory and industrial testing. A transparent, heat-resistant observation window allows users to safely monitor the burning process, while integrated safety features ensure operator protection. The unit is designed in accordance with major global standards such as ASTM E84, ISO 11925, UL 94, and BIS norms, making it suitable for use by testing laboratories, R&D departments, quality assurance teams, and regulatory bodies.
